Class 11 Mathematics Chapter 7 Binomial Theorem

Chapter 7 Binomial Theorem in Class 11 Mathematics introduces students to one of the most powerful algebraic tools used for expanding expressions of the form (a+b)n(a + b)^n. The chapter explores the history and significance of the binomial theorem, deriving its formula through mathematical induction. It covers key concepts such as binomial coefficients, general terms, middle terms, and the properties of Pascal’s Triangle. The theorem’s applications in algebra, probability, and real-world calculations are also discussed. This chapter helps students develop problem-solving skills by learning how to expand binomial expressions efficiently without direct multiplication.
